Recipe for Black Bean Enchiladas

Yield:
8 Servings
Ingredients:
Amount Ingredient
1 cup Black beans
1 cup Red beans (or use all black beans, or 1/3 red, black & pintos), soaked overnight
6 cup Water or vegetable stock
1 x Bay leaf
2 cup Fresh tomatoes, chopped
1 lrg Onion, chopped
1 can (small) corn
1 cup Diced poblanos
1 cup Diced red bell pepper (or yellow or both)
Lots and lots of chopped garlic
2 tsp Cumin
4 x Serranos
Salt to taste
Instructions:
Instructions: In a big pot, combine the beans, water, and bay leaf. Bring to boil, reduce heat and simmer for an hour or so until tender. Add the tomatoes, onion, corn, peppers, garlic, cumin and chiles. Simmer for 15 minutes, add the cilantro.

Take flour tortillas (or corn, but dip them in some stock to soften, or nuke them), fill with 1/2 cup of the beans and roll, placing seam side down in a dish. Nuke (or bake) until hot. Pour more beans over, and tomatillo salsa, garnish with sour cream.
